Does Budweiser have barley?
Anheuser-Busch lists the same ingredients for Budweiser and Bud Light on their website tapintoyourbeer.com: water, barley malt, rice, yeast and hops. … the company said it is not required to list the ingredients of its products, but will do so at the request of Americans.

Does the Blue Moon have barley?
Blue Moon’s food bill includes barley malt, white wheat, orange zest, coriander and oats – often paired with a slice of orange, which brewers claim can accentuate the beer’s flavour. Available in cans, bottles and kegs, Blue Moon contains 5.4% alcohol by volume.
